Wind is caused by differences in pressure in the atmospheric air surrounding the earth. The sun warms the earth, and its air, inconsistently. As different regions of air become warm and cool, the atmospheric pressure changes to pockets of low and high pressure. As these different pressure pockets collide, wind is produced.
Wind shear is when wind speed and direction are different over a short period of time. Shear can be vertical or horizontal.
The wind direction is measured with wind vanes or wind socks. The wind speed is measured with an anemometer.

An anemometer is a device that provides information on wind speed and wind pressure. Sonic anemometers measure the wind speed and pressure of sonic pulses that exist between pairs of transducers.
